How carpet fitting works in Clapham

Five steps, the same on every SW4 job, so you know what happens before you commit.   1. Step 1

    Measure and plan the seams

    Room measured with the pile direction planned so seams fall away from the window and the main sight line.

  2. Step 2

    Uplift and check the subfloor

    Old floor lifted, boards screwed down where they creak, and any damp or rot flagged before we go further.

  3. Step 3

    Gripper and underlay

    Gripper pinned or glued at the correct gap from the skirting, underlay laid staggered and taped.

  4. Step 4

    Fit and stretch

    Carpet rough-cut, kicked and stretched properly so it will not ripple in six months, then trimmed in.

  5. Step 5

    Bars, doors and clear-up

    Doorbars fitted, doors trimmed if needed, off-cuts and old carpet taken away.

Carpet fitting prices in Clapham

Fixed prices for SW4 and the rest of Lambeth. Floor area, stair count and access set the price. Winders, bay windows and awkward thresholds all add cutting time, and an unlevel subfloor adds preparation before fitting starts.
Carpet fitting price guide for Clapham SW4
JobFromTypical timeWhat sets the price
Single room up to 12m²£1201.5–2.5 hrsGripper, underlay, one seam at most, and a doorbar at each threshold.
Room 12–20m²£1802–3 hrsA wider room usually needs a seam, and a seam is where a bad fit shows first.
Straight staircase, 13 treads£2203–4 hrsEach tread and riser is cut and kicked individually; winders on a London turn cost more again.
Landing and stairs together£3204–6 hrsPriced as one job because the landing carpet has to run into the top tread invisibly.
Lifting and disposing of old carpet, per room£4520–40 minOld carpet and underlay go to a licensed transfer station with a waste transfer note.
Door trimming, per door£2515–25 minA new underlay adds height; the door is taken off, planed and rehung so it clears.

Fitting labour only — carpet, underlay, gripper and doorbars can be supplied at cost or you can buy your own. Uplift and disposal of the old floor is priced per room and comes with a waste transfer note. Permits, ULEZ and the Congestion Charge where they apply are itemised in the quote.
